On the real GFC 700, FLC mode does not control the engines. It controls the pitch of the aircraft to maintain a certain speed regardless of the power setting.

 

The Phenom 100 does not have an autothrottle and no autopilot mode will adjust power settings to maintain airspeed.

Exactly which is why I say FLC is not working. If I select 200 kts the attitude would change (nose would lower) as I climb with a constant power setting. It does not in this plane.

 

In real life it's basically a stall prevention climb mode.

A bit more time in the pilot's seat and.....

 

(1) I was initially concerned about the high stall speed (clean) but finally found some credible data posted below. It is a fast plane, a fast wing, and stalls higher than the Mustang for sure. V2 at 107 KTS...

 

Limiting and Recommended Airspeeds:

 

•V1 (takeoff decision speed), flaps 1 | 102 KIAS

•VR (rotation), flaps 1 | 104 KIAS

•VMC, landing (icing conditions) | 97 KIAS

•VMC, landing (no icing conditions) | 86 KIAS

•V2 (takeoff safety speed), flaps 1 | 107 KIAS

•VFE (max flap extended)

•@10 degrees | 200 KIAS

•@26 degrees | 160 KIAS

•@36 degrees | 145 KIAS

•VLE (max gear extended) | 275 KIAS

Just did another quick test flight.....a few observations regarding FLC and FADEC:

 

FLC - Not working. Acting as an auto throttle / speed hold and not as a real FLC. When engaged, the aircraft was changing power settings to keep the selected airspeed. This was with the autopilot disengaged....no pitch commands were present on the Flight Director.

 

FADEC - Not working:

-Changing the thrust mode on the G1000 does not appear to have an effect on the available thrust.

-ITT spiked well into the red on startup. (with a 26C OAT)...FADEC should shut down the engine in the event of a hot start.

-On the ground, when the power levers were increased past the Max CRZ position, ITT increased into the red. (FADEC should prevent any temperature excursions)
